Horizon Forbidden West Receives New Gameplay Trailer

Guerrilla Games debuted a new gameplay trailer for the upcoming open world action RPG at The Game Awards 2021.

Guerrilla Games and Sony have been sharing new updates and snippets for Horizon Forbidden West at a pretty regular clip in the last few months, and they recently also took the stage at The Game Awards 2021 to showcase a new gameplay trailer for it. It’s a pretty brief trailer, all things considered, but a pretty packed one. Check it out below.

Mechanics such as the Shieldwing and underwater traversal and exploration can be seen in glimpses in this trailer again, while we also get to see new snippets of combat and traversal. Perhaps more importantly for those looking forward to the game, there’s plenty of new stuff to look at as well- including new locations and more than a few formidable looking new machines and monstrosities, including what looks like a massive mechanical snake wrapped around a building.

Horizon Forbidden West is due out on February 18, 2022 for PS5 and PS4.
